Important Elements of Modern Slots

Modern slot machines are a testament to human creativity and the lasting appeal of a classic form of entertainment. They have grown from mechanical wonders to the breathtaking and technologically advanced digital spectacles we are seeing today.

In the 1960s, electromechanical slots were popular. These allowed players to win on multiple lines such as diagonal and zig-zagged patterns.

Reels

Every slot machine is built around reels. Whether they're the physical machines in the mechanical slot machine or the virtual reels of an online video poker Slots game, slot machines use them to display symbols and determine winning combinations. They're a vital part of the slot machine experience, and capture players' imaginations by their intricate sequence of rows and symbols.

As technology developed and technology improved, manufacturers began adding more reels to slot machines in order to offer more complex gameplay and bonus features. The new reels improved the odds for a winning combination and allowed higher payouts. This made the games more enjoyable to play.

The position of the reels can impact a player's chances of winning. They may be pushed after a spin to increase their chances. This is similar to the older mechanical slot machines where players would press an button or pull a lever to spin the reels. This method does not alter the outcome of a spin, however. The Random Number Generator (RNG) determines the outcome, which is independent of spinner actions.

Unlike the physical mechanisms of a mechanical machine, modern slot machines make use of virtual reels to display symbols and determine winning combinations. When the reels stop spinning they show a random mix of symbols and a winning combination is determined by the amount of symbols that match in the payline. While the game's mechanics might appear different, the results are still determined by a random number generator which generates an array of random numbers every millisecond.

If you're watching symbols swoop in a domino effect or navigating the myriad ways of Megaways, innovative reel mechanics are changing the way slot machines function. They provide new levels of complexity and excitement, as well as the potential for winnings that traditional slot machines can't match.

Symbols

The symbols are equally important as the reels in modern slots. They can determine your chances of winning. The symbols are available in various sizes shapes, colors, and colors and are designed in accordance with the theme of the game. These symbols can also be used to trigger bonus rounds and unlock special features. In addition to the regular symbols, a few modern slot games feature special multipliers and wilds that can increase the amount you win.

The symbols of slot machines vary from machine to machine, however they all have a common history. The first slot machines had symbols that were based on chewing gum sticks or gum packets. The bar symbolised a chewing-gum stick, while the lucky 7s were associated with different beliefs about luck. Other symbols used in slot machines include the Liberty Bell, and the Horseshoe.

Modern interactive slots have adapted classic icons to fit their unique themes. Each slot features different symbols and combinations to create a unique gameplay. Some modern slot machines include characters from popular video games or movies and others feature items that relate to the theme. The number of symbols used does not influence the chance of hitting the payline. This is determined by complex random number generators.

Paylines

Paylines are a crucial aspect of slot games. They determine how much a player can earn on one spin of the reels. They also affect the frequency of hits on a slot machine, which impacts the overall experience. The majority of modern slot machines have multiple paylines, ranging from one to 100 lines. These are usually called "ways to win," and they can be displayed as numbers or grid on the screen. The player can view these paylines either by watching the screen or clicking on the information button.

If a player wants to play with all paylines in active they need to adjust their budget to accommodate this. Paylines don't guarantee winnings. The payout ratios of a game will determine the frequency at which the slot pays and changing the paylines will reduce the chances of winning the jackpot.

A traditional slot machine has a single payline running straight down the middle of the 3x3 grid. This type of slot is great for those who prefer traditional games and a lot of people opt to play them since they're simple to understand. There are different types of slots out there, so don't decide on a slot based on how many paylines a slot features. Instead, choose slots that have the right RTP and volatility level and the right themes and features for the game.

The direction of the paylines varies between slots, however the majority follow a pattern from left to right. This is how the majority of slot players are used to playing, and it's the best way to maximize the chances of lining up symbols to win big. However certain modern slots don't use paylines but instead rely on scatters and bonus features to trigger special events and free spins.

Bonus rounds

Modern online slots are extremely immersive and offer a variety of different features and bonus rounds. Free spins, jackpots and pick-and-win games are just a few of the features. These features are designed to increase your chances of winning as well as to add excitement to the game. In addition, some modern slots also feature progressive jackpots that increase each time a player spins the reels.

Modern slot machines differ from their mechanical counterparts. They no longer use mechanical components or reels. Instead, they utilise computer programs to control the functions and generate results. This technology has enabled developers to create elaborate slots that have high-definition graphics as well as immersive experiences. It's not a surprise that they've become one of the most sought-after ways to gamble on the internet.

These days, most slot machines come with multiple paylines and various graphical styles. They are usually accompanied by engaging animations and short scenes that tell the story of the main character. The current slot industry is booming, with game developers constantly looking for new ways to integrate these elements into the gaming experience.

Bonus rounds in modern slots can take many forms, such as scatters, free spins and random jackpots. Some bonus rounds are activated by certain combinations of symbols that appear on the reels. Some require that the player take a specific action. Certain bonus games offer progressive prizes that can be as high as seven figures.

Modern slots also come with reel modifiers that alter the way that symbols appear on the screen. Some of them have expandable wilds that replace other symbols and add additional paylines to the reels. Some even alter the number of paylines active and give players the chance to win.

Themes

Themes are a crucial element of the success of a slot machine. They help to distinguish the game from other games and attract a large audience. Themes have evolved from traditional bars and cherry symbols of old to more complex designs, and are often used in conjunction with other elements to create a comprehensive gaming experience. Themes are a fantastic way to engage players, and they can provide an exciting backdrop for your casino adventures.

Slot games can be themed on anything from blockbuster films to ancient civilizations. Themes can be based upon almost every subject, and software developers use them as a starting point for the creation of an original game. Themes can be used in specific features and symbols, or used to create an entire slot machine.

Slots that are based on popular culture are becoming popular. Music and videos are added to the game experience to enhance it. These games are extremely popular among both younger and older players. They allow players to replay their favorite moments from movies or TV shows, or even music artists.

Another trend that has been gaining popularity is slots inspired by sports teams and sporting events. These games can be a lot of fun and offer the chance to win large prizes. However, players should be cautious about the amount of time they invest in these kinds of games.

Adventure and fantasy are also popular themes. Game players can enjoy games that transport them to magical forests, dense jungles or even beneath the sea. These themes are also featured in the most popular titles like Dragon Spin, Dragon Wild and Jungle Jackpot. These games provide unique experiences that let players escape into another world.
